
Overview
The curriculum of the Public Policy program at University of Maryland Baltimore County (UMBC) is divided into core courses, disciplinary foundation courses and courses in a specific policy area or discipline. Students with a master’s degree will have fewer course requirements.
Structure
Students seeking the Ph.D. degree must pass must pass a comprehensive exam course (PUBL 609), and write and defend a dissertation. Each doctoral student plans an individual curriculum with his or her advisor.
The 48 hours of formal course work normally includes the six core courses, one course in each of the three foundation disciplines (economics, political science and sociology), five courses in an area of concentration and two relevant elective courses. Students with appropriate previous training may complete their course work with fewer credits required.

General requirements
- The application will prompt you to provide the names and emails of at least 3 faculty recommenders, a statement of goals, and a list of colleges attended, majors and GPAs, as well as scores on the GRE general test* and the TOEFL Scores (for international applicants). You will also need to submit official transcripts from each university attended. A current resume is also required by the program, and may be linked to the application.
